I know JS and ReactJS, but What should be my next step?

Have you ever considered what further knowledge may be required to elevate your programming skills? Do you understand what the next step for utilizing JavaScript and ReactJS could be? Is there an avenue to become more experienced in the field of programming? In this article, you will learn the skills necessary to take your Javascript and ReactJS knowledge to the next level.
Developers tend to have difficulty finding the right way to bridge the knowledge gaps and progress their programming skills. It is a well-documented problem and has been studied extensively by the tech community. According to a study conducted at Clemson University, 90 percent of coders often feel frustrated when trying to find ways to develop their skills in a certain language or framework. Furthermore, the developers admitted having difficulty determining what techniques they should explore next.
In this article, you will learn how to use JavaScript and ReactJS to take your programming skills to the next level by focusing on and leveraging current industry standards. We will address the advantages of JavaScript and ReactJS and how they can be used to further your programming career. We will provide a step-by-step guide to finding resources online, attending events, and networking with experienced professionals in the field, and much more. After reading this article, you will have the necessary knowledge and tools to pursue your programming career ambitions.Heading: Definitions of JS and ReactJS
JS (JavaScript) is the scripting language of the web. It is used to create interactive web pages and web applications. It is an object-oriented language which includes features like loops, functions, variables, and classes. JavaScript can be used to create websites, mobile apps, asynchronous applications, dynamic web sites, and much more.
ReactJS is an open-source JavaScript library created by Facebook in 2013. It is used for developing user interfaces for single-page applications. ReactJS is fast and efficient and easy to learn, making it suitable for creating lightweight user interfaces. ReactJS is also known for its virtual DOM (Document Object Model) which allows developers to build user interfaces with very little effort.
By combining the two, web developers can create fast and interactive UIs for a variety of applications. The use of JavaScript and ReactJS together allows flexibility and scalability when creating user interfaces. ReactJS provides an easy-to-use interface that makes it easier to create dynamic UIs, while JavaScript provides the ability to add more complex functionality. Together they make for a powerful combination of development tools.

Hot brief overview is ready for reading:  Does React require Node.js?

2. Gaining Experience with ReactJS

Why Gaining Experience with ReactJS Is Important

ReactJS is a popular open-source JavaScript library used to create the user interface of a web application. Despite its popularity, however, many developers lack sufficient experience with ReactJS, leading to a range of difficulties in developing applications. This is why gaining experience with ReactJS is so important.
First and foremost, ReactJS is a powerful tool for developing user interfaces efficiently. Developers must understand its core principles and syntax in order to create efficient, attractive, and functionally sound user interfaces and web applications. Experienced ReactJS developers are able to produce quality work faster than developers without enough experience, in some cases making the difference between success and failure.
In addition, mastering ReactJS can also open up new opportunities. Often an employer will look for an experienced ReactJS developer to fill a position. Because of this, developers who have experience with ReactJS have a competitive edge in the job market, and may find themselves better compensated and with more options than their competition.
Finally, understanding ReactJS also allows developers to further their own development several ways. Developers can build their own libraries and frameworks, creating their own powerful tools. They can also create custom plugins for existing libraries, expanding upon what is already available. With ReactJS experience developers will have access to a wide variety of development resources, adding additional options and making development more efficient.

Practical Ways to Gain ReactJS Experience

Gaining ReactJS experience can be done either through traditional methods such as courses or self-learning. For those who want to use courses, there are several excellent options from both physical courses and online video courses. These allow developers to learn ReactJS in a more structured environment, and provide assistance and guidance for their development journey. Regardless of the courses, ReactJS developers should also take part in online forums and read blogs so they can stay up to date with the latest developments and best practices.
For self-learners, ReactJS can be explored through online resources such as tutorials, articles, and blogs. This can be done in an entirely self-led and self-paced environment, allowing developers to learn at their own speed and explore only the topics and areas that they are interested in. Experimentation is the best way to learn ReactJS, and learning how to develop a simple project from scratch is an excellent way to gain experience and find one’s way around the development process.

Hot brief overview is ready for reading:  Which platform is best for JavaScript and React?

3. Taking the Next Step in JavaScript and ReactJS

Getting Started With ES6

As the JavaScript language continues to evolve, the version known as ES6 (EcmaScript2015) continues to gain traction. ES6 syntax adds a variety of useful and powerful features to the language, making it easier to create complex and robust applications with JavaScript. ES6 introduces features such as classes, generators, iterators, arrow functions, and much more. By learning and understanding these new tools, developers can take their JavaScript skills to the next level.

Exploring the Benefits of ReactJS

One popular library for developing with JavaScript is ReactJS. React is a library for building user interface components and is highly beneficial for creating intricate application and web page designs. React is a great tool for developers, as it actively enforces simple design patterns, emphasizes testability, and is built on a component-based architecture that’s great for creating reusable libraries. React is an incredibly important tool in any modern JavaScript developer’s toolkit and should be understood and utilized whenever possible.

Sharpening Your Knowledge of Modern JavaScript

No matter what language or library you are using, sharpening your knowledge and understanding of the underlying language will help you in the long run, and JavaScript is no exception. The language provides a plethora of features, built-in objects, and powerful design strategies that you can use to create powerful applications. Once you have a strong foundation of the language, the possibilities to create feature-rich applications are much higher. Developing a strong understanding of the language is an invaluable asset in your toolkit.
Overall, JavaScript and ReactJS are incredibly powerful tools used to create modern web applications. In order to take full advantage of these tools, it is important to understand and use the features of ES6 as well as the benefits of ReactJS. Additionally, a strong understanding of the language itself should be honed in order to produce powerful applications.


What could be the next step for mastering modern web development? It is an exciting journey and there is no clear destination. As frontend and backend technologies evolve, there are always newer and better tools and frameworks that developers can use. To stay up to date and take full advantage of the ever-expanding array of technologies, developers must stay disciplined and practice regularly.
Staying up to date on modern web development tools and frameworks can be a daunting task. To make their lives easier, developers can follow blog posts, social media, newsletters, classes and any other available resources to stay informed. We would love for all our readers to follow along as we release the latest updates and tutorials. So be sure to like, follow, and subscribe to our blog posts for the latest news.
Frequently Asked Questions
Q: What is the best way to stay up to date on modern web development technologies?
A: The best way to stay up to date is to follow blog posts, social media, newsletters, classes and any other available resources. Staying consistent and regularly practicing is key to mastering modern web development technologies.
Q: How can I learn modern web development technologies?
A: There are a variety of learning methods one can employ to learn modern web development technologies. Online resources and classes are a great resource, as well as reading blogs, tutorials, and newspapers.
Q: What technologies should I focus on first?
A: It is important to learn HTML, CSS, and JavaScript first, as they are the three core technologies of the web. It’s also helpful to learn a JavaScript library such as React or Angular.
Q: Do I need to be experienced in coding in order to learn modern web development technologies?
A: Yes, in order to take full advantage of modern web development technologies, it is important to first understand the basics of coding. With enough experience, students will be able to take their knowledge to the next level.
Q: How often should I practice coding?
A: It is important to practice coding consistently in order to stay up to date with new technologies. Regularly refreshing existing skills in combination with learning the newer technologies is essential.

Leave a Reply

Your email address will not be published. Required fields are marked *